    Types of Price Averages: Beyond the Simple Mean

    When we talk about the "average price," we usually implicitly refer to the arithmetic mean. This is calculated by summing all the prices and dividing by the number of prices. While simple to calculate, it's susceptible to distortion by outliers – unusually high or low prices. For example, the average price of houses in a neighborhood could be skewed significantly upwards if a single mansion is included in the dataset.

    Other types of averages offer different perspectives:

    • Median: The median price is the middle value when prices are arranged in ascending order. It's less sensitive to outliers than the mean, providing a more robust measure of central tendency, especially when dealing with skewed distributions. Imagine a situation where most houses cost around $250,000 but one sells for $2 million. The median price would give a much clearer picture of the typical house price.

    • Mode: The mode is the most frequent price in a dataset. It’s useful for identifying the most common price point, although it might not be representative of the overall price range if the data is widely dispersed.

    • Weighted Average: A weighted average assigns different weights to different prices based on their significance. For instance, if a retailer sells three different quantities of a product at different prices, the weighted average price reflects the overall average price considering the sales volume of each item. This is particularly relevant when analyzing sales data where different quantities are sold at different price points.

    • Geometric Mean: The geometric mean is calculated by multiplying all the prices and then taking the nth root, where n is the number of prices. It's particularly useful when dealing with percentages or rates of change over time, such as compound interest or annual price changes. It’s less influenced by extreme values than the arithmetic mean.

    Factors Influencing Price Averages: Unpacking the Numbers

    Several factors significantly influence the average price observed in a market or dataset. Understanding these factors is critical for proper interpretation and application of average price data:

    • Market Conditions: Supply and demand play a crucial role. High demand and low supply typically lead to higher average prices, while the opposite leads to lower prices. Economic booms and recessions drastically affect price averages across various sectors.

    • Seasonality: Certain products or services experience price fluctuations throughout the year. For example, the average price of fresh produce may be higher in winter due to reduced availability. Understanding seasonality is essential for comparing prices across different periods.

    • Inflation: Inflation erodes the purchasing power of money, leading to a general increase in prices over time. When analyzing price averages over extended periods, it's crucial to adjust for inflation to gain a more accurate understanding of real price changes.

    • Technological Advancements: Technological innovation can impact prices in several ways. New technologies might reduce production costs, leading to lower average prices, or they might create entirely new products with varying price points.

    • Government Regulations: Government policies, such as taxes, subsidies, and import tariffs, can influence price averages. Taxes increase prices, while subsidies can lower them. Import tariffs raise the prices of imported goods.

    • Competition: The level of competition in a market significantly affects prices. Highly competitive markets tend to have lower average prices than markets dominated by a few players.

    Interpreting Average Prices: The Pitfalls of Oversimplification

    While average prices provide a convenient summary statistic, they can be misleading if not interpreted cautiously. Here are some critical considerations:

    • Outliers: As mentioned, extreme values can significantly skew the arithmetic mean. Always consider the distribution of prices and examine the data for outliers that might be distorting the average. The median often provides a more robust representation in such cases.

    • Data Representativeness: The average price is only meaningful if the data used to calculate it is representative of the population of interest. A small, biased sample can lead to inaccurate conclusions.

    • Context Matters: Average prices should always be interpreted within their context. Understanding the factors that influence prices is crucial for proper interpretation. A high average price might be expected in a luxury market, while a low average price might be typical in a highly competitive market.

    • Time Frame: The time frame used to calculate the average price significantly impacts the result. Comparing average prices across different time periods requires adjusting for inflation and considering seasonal variations.

    Practical Applications of Average Price Analysis

    Average price analysis finds widespread application in various fields:

    • Market Research: Businesses use average price data to understand market trends, price their products competitively, and forecast future demand.

    • Investment Decisions: Investors use average prices to assess the value of assets and make informed investment decisions.

    • Economic Policy: Governments use average price data to monitor inflation, track economic growth, and design effective economic policies.

    • Personal Finance: Consumers use average price comparisons to make informed purchasing decisions and manage their budgets effectively.

    • Real Estate: Real estate professionals use average prices to determine property values, assess market trends, and advise clients.

    Frequently Asked Questions (FAQ)

    Q1: What's the difference between the mean, median, and mode in the context of price averages?

    A1: The mean is the arithmetic average, calculated by summing all prices and dividing by the number of prices. The median is the middle value when prices are arranged in order. The mode is the most frequent price. The median is often preferred when dealing with outliers that can skew the mean.

    Q2: How can I adjust for inflation when comparing average prices over time?

    A2: You can use inflation indices, such as the Consumer Price Index (CPI), to adjust for inflation. You'll need to find the CPI values for the relevant years and use them to convert historical prices into current-dollar equivalents.

    Q3: What are some common sources for obtaining average price data?

    A3: Various government agencies, industry associations, market research firms, and online databases publish average price data. The reliability and accuracy of the data vary depending on the source.

    Q4: Why is understanding the distribution of prices important when analyzing average prices?

    A4: Understanding the distribution helps identify potential outliers and provides a more comprehensive picture of price variation. A skewed distribution might indicate that the mean isn't a reliable measure of central tendency, and the median might be a more appropriate representation.
